What “20x20” truthfully approach for paint
A 20 by using 20 room is four hundred square toes of floor, but painters can charge off surface sector, no longer flooring field. A normal Cape Coral ceiling is eight to ten ft top. If we assume eight toes and customary door and window openings, wall surface comes out approximately like this:
- Perimeter is 80 linear feet. Multiply by eight feet tall, and you get round 640 square toes of wall. Subtract openings. A normal door is about 21 square toes. Two first rate sized home windows collectively would dispose of 30 to forty square toes. That nevertheless leaves roughly 570 to 590 sq. toes of paintable wall. Add the ceiling if it is included, it's a different four hundred sq. feet. Baseboards, doors, and crown molding, if they may be being painted, add time and resources.
For walls basically, so much 20x20 rooms inside the Cape Coral field land among 550 and 650 square feet of paintable wall. With ceiling and trim incorporated, you're in the direction of 1,000 rectangular toes of surfaces that desire exertions and components.

What influences the fee the most
Prep makes or breaks a paint task the following. Florida humidity indicates up as hairline cracks alongside outdated caulk joints, and salt air can push dirt into stucco and trim over the years. On interiors, the major variables are:
- Condition of partitions. Patching nail pops, settling cracks at corners, and dents from furniture provides hard work. One hour will become three if we're doing compound, dry, sand, and re-prime cycles. Texture. Knockdown or orange peel textures are forgiving. Skim coat delicate walls are less forgiving, so we spend more time on sanding, priming, and laying off the roller to prevent flashing. Color shift. Covering navy, purple, or black with a easy neutral takes primer. Painting over bright yellow with a cool grey might also desire further coats owing to undertone adjustments. Ceilings and trim. Spraying trim for a manufacturing unit conclude skill protecting and dust keep watch over. Brushing and rolling trim is slower yet is also powerful in occupied homes. Occupied vs empty. Moving and overlaying fixtures, covering flooring, and coordinating get entry to takes time. Empty rooms move instant and keep fee. Height and get right of entry to. 10 foot ceilings and vaults require taller ladders and staged work. That adds deploy cycles.
Material preferences we advise for Cape Coral homes
In Southwest Florida, interior humidity is the baseline thing. We search for coatings that resist mold, contact up effectively, and do no longer flash easily in shiny, raking solar.
- Walls: a washable matte or eggshell acrylic in residing regions, satin in kitchens and baths. Ceilings: excellent flat ceiling paint to conceal taped joints and rolling patterns within the glare of afternoon sun. Trim and doors: sturdy waterborne enamel with a soft satin sheen that cures difficult however does no longer amber like vintage oil products.

Timing and Florida climate: while paint behaves best
What time of yr is fabulous to paint? For exteriors in our weather, the dry season is your pal. The stretch from November to March can provide cooler mornings, diminish humidity, and greater good afternoons. Is October too overdue to paint outdoors? Not in any respect. October often works good when storms provide approach to drier air, but avert a watch on tropical programs. Afternoon showers and high humidity gradual dry occasions, which can trap moisture below brand new coats and bring about peeling later.
What is the premiere month to color a home in Florida? If we should elect one, December is often impressive for exteriors in Cape Coral. Hard colours and intelligent primers
What is the toughest color to paint over? Red and deep orange correct the record. Strong blues and black run near at the back of. Neon and brilliant yellow surprise people too, as a result of they flicker using easy neutrals and demand extra policy cover. A gray tinted stain blocking primer is the workhorse answer for dramatic shifts, followed via two end Painter coats. It bills greater up entrance yet saves time and paint, and avoids the ghosting we all dread.

Signs of a awful paint job
You can spot complication in the first week when you comprehend where to look:
- Lap marks or “vacation trips,” in which you see lighter stripes whilst the light rakes throughout a wall “Picture framing,” where minimize in edges flash differently than the rolled field Runs, sags, or heavy stipple from overloading the roller Missed caulk joints at baseboards or crown, the place shadows display gaps Premature peeling or bad adhesion when tape is lifted
What are prevalent portray errors? Skipping primer on slick or stained surfaces, applying the incorrect nap for the wall texture, rolling too speedy and too dry, ignoring brand spread premiums, and failing to defend a wet area all instruct up inside the conclude. In Florida, portray too late in the day on a cooling, damp outside can trap moisture. We degree coats to dodge that.

The 80/20 rule in painting
Painters talk approximately the eighty/20 conception this method: eighty percentage of a high-quality end is floor prep and staging, and 20 p.c. is the noticeable rolling and combing. Homeowners broadly speaking choose to hurry to shade, but the hours spent washing partitions, filling dents, sanding, priming, and caulking determine how the gentle reads your room. We build the ones hours into our estimates seeing that they're the distinction among a activity that appears high-quality on day one and a activity that still seems crisp years later.

A few area circumstances we see often
Vaulted residing rooms. Many Cape Coral homes have tall own family rooms that open to lanais. Those vaults are amazing yet sluggish. Expect an additional seek advice from on the grounds that we need to level ladders and work in sections for safety.
Kitchen and bath humidity. Semi Residential Painter gloss used to be the default. Today’s washable matte and satin paints participate in effectively and seem to be greater modern day. Still, if a bathtub has minimal air flow, we spec mildewcide enhanced paints.
DIY patches. Joint compound desires to dry completely previously paint. In our humidity, deep fills can seem to be dry but nevertheless grasp moisture. Priming with the precise sealer prevents flashing.
Fresh drywall. New drywall need to be primed with a high quality PVA or acrylic primer. Skipping it should telegraph every taped joint as soon as sun hits the wall by way of sliding doors.
